diff options
author | Dave Airlie <airlied@redhat.com> | 2015-06-22 13:59:25 +1000 |
---|---|---|
committer | Dave Airlie <airlied@redhat.com> | 2015-06-23 15:54:07 +1000 |
commit | 1a71fbe28ca0525b618f6fb9d7354f3a6589af2f (patch) | |
tree | 9b1ba492c69abd08667fde724ca9d77846ada0b9 /src/gallium/auxiliary/draw/draw_llvm.h | |
parent | 40d225803ecfa805b4dea4ee0ebd04df00ca8827 (diff) | |
download | external_mesa3d-1a71fbe28ca0525b618f6fb9d7354f3a6589af2f.zip external_mesa3d-1a71fbe28ca0525b618f6fb9d7354f3a6589af2f.tar.gz external_mesa3d-1a71fbe28ca0525b618f6fb9d7354f3a6589af2f.tar.bz2 |
draw/gallivm: add invocation ID support for llvmpipe.
This extends the draw code to add support for invocations.
Reviewed-by: Roland Scheidegger <sroland@vmware.com>
Signed-off-by: Dave Airlie <airlied@redhat.com>
Diffstat (limited to 'src/gallium/auxiliary/draw/draw_llvm.h')
-rw-r--r-- | src/gallium/auxiliary/draw/draw_llvm.h |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/gallium/auxiliary/draw/draw_llvm.h b/src/gallium/auxiliary/draw/draw_llvm.h index 9565fc6..d48ed72 100644 --- a/src/gallium/auxiliary/draw/draw_llvm.h +++ b/src/gallium/auxiliary/draw/draw_llvm.h @@ -298,7 +298,8 @@ typedef int struct vertex_header *output, unsigned num_prims, unsigned instance_id, - int *prim_ids); + int *prim_ids, + unsigned invocation_id); struct draw_llvm_variant_key { |